ABOUT FCC FCC is Canada’s leading agriculture and food lender, dedicated to the industry that feeds the world. FCC employees are committed to the long-standing success of those who produce and process Canadian food by providing flexible financing, AgExpert business management software, information and knowledge. FCC provides a complement of expertise and services designed to support the complex and evolving needs of food businesses. As a financial Crown corporation, FCC is a stable partner that reinvests profits back into the industry and communities it serves. For more information, visit fcc.ca. RFP CONTACT Ronke Niagwan Procurement Manager Farm Credit Canada procurement@fcc.ca RFP SCOPE FCC currently has a Human Capital Management (HCM) Platform that has been in place for 6 years. Since that time there have been changes in how HCM Strategy is delivered at a process and organizational level across all industries. FCC is looking to mature it’s HCM Strategy to allow for a new workforce and flexible ways of delivering the HCM Function. As a result of this maturity FCC requires an HCM Platform that is flexible and adaptable to deliver on this strategy through technology. FCC has roughly 3200 employees and consultants across Canada plus candidates that apply for jobs. FCC is looking for one (1) successful Proponent that will provide a single Platform that will help FCC achieve the business needs stated below. However, FCC reserves the right to award the RFP scope of service to one or multiple Proponents to ensure the success of the HCM Function. The successful proponent would also implement and migrate any data to the new Platform. Summary of Business Needs: Human Capital Management Platform  FCC is looking for a Human Capital Management Platform that will meet our current and future Human Capital Management Functions and as well provide improvements through technology to those processes. The Platform should be flexible to grow with FCC and the Human Capital Management function Implementation FCC would require the successful proponent to implement the Platform. FCC is open to the proponent partnering with a 3rd party to deliver the implementation. On-Going Advisory Support    FCC may require the successful proponent to provide On-Going Advisory Support post implementation. This support could include but is not limited to:  Platform Configuration   Platform Assessment or Validation  Platform Enhancements  FCC requires that any proposed Platform be submitted only once. Platform providers or resellers must submit their proposal in partnership with their preferred implementation partner. Multiple proposals for the same Platform from different implementation partners or as standalone submissions will NOT be accepted. Each proposal must clearly identify the implementation partner, and the Platform provider is responsible for coordinating with their chosen partner to deliver a single comprehensive proposal.  More details of scope and requirements are included in the RFP document. RFP PROCESS CONSIDERATIONS   This opportunity is covered under the provisions of Chapter 5 (Government Procurement) of the Canadian Free Trade Agreement (CFTA) and Chapter 19 (Government Procurement) of the Canada-European Union Comprehensive Economic and Trade Agreement (CETA). FCC is subject to the Official Languages Act (Canada). Proponents may choose to respond to this RFP in their official language of choice (English or French). This opportunity notice references a non-binding, competitive RFP, and is not a call for tenders. FCC is not obligated to proceed with the Work described in the RFP Scope and may cancel the RFP at any time. FCC’s procurement process allows for consecutive or concurrent negotiations between FCC and one (1) or multiple Proponents, prior to awarding a Contract.
